Flexibility

Robot vacuums and mops are becoming more readily available, with features that were previously considered expensive now being made available in mid-range models. This has led to variety of improvements in their cleaning capabilities and navigation capabilities, noise levels, and user-friendliness.

Autonomous vacuums that utilize advanced mapping technology are able to detect and avoid objects and navigate around furniture with great accuracy. They are also able to navigate between rooms without becoming stuck. They can also adjust their routes to make sure they can clean every corner of your house. They can also get into tight spaces where other robots struggle.

The mapping technology will be an essential feature for any robot cleaner that is worth its price by 2024. Auto-vacuums without mapping technology are more likely to bump into furniture or become caught in shoes, cords, and pet toys. This can cause the entire cleaning process to get thrown off and leave missed spots. Smart mapping capability is usually available in budget-friendly models made by reliable brands like Shark or Roborock and it's worth the extra cost.

Some robots allow you to set up virtual barriers within the app, that prevent your device from entering certain parts of your home. For example, around a pile or dog poop. This feature is especially useful if you have children or pets who tend to leave things lying around. It's simple to create several no-go zones and schedule them to run at various times during the day, based on your schedule like.

Auto-empty is another great feature. It automatically transfers the contents of a bin that is robotic to a larger bag at the base station. This reduces the time spent maintaining and emptying the robot. This lets you keep your house cleaner with less effort and reduces allergies due to the less exposure to dust and dirt.

Another helpful option is docking stations that replace mop pads automatically so that you don't need to do it manually. This is particularly useful for families with pets who tend to frequent the same space frequently like the kitchen and family room.

Some of the most sophisticated robotic vacuums utilize laser-based navigation systems to map a space. LiDAR sensors on the base of these machines bounce infrared light beams off the walls and floors to determine distances, and create digital maps that help them navigate spaces efficiently. This technology is more precise than traditional ultrasonic and infrared sensors, which are more susceptible to changes in lighting conditions. It's also less vulnerable to interference, making it an ideal choice for various types of surfaces.

Another smart navigation feature found in some autonomous vacuums is the ability to recognize objects. The sensor-based technology detects moving objects like shoes, toys, and charging cables to avoid them from being cleaned and to avoid accidents such as collisions or damage to furniture.
